What is the force acting on a 0.5 C charge from the side of an electric field with a strength of 12V / m.

The electric field strength can be calculated using the formula:
E = F / q, where E is the strength of the electric field (E = 12 V / m), F is the force with which the electric field acts on the charge (H), q is the magnitude of the electric charge (q = 0.5 C).
Let us express and calculate the force of action on the charge:
F = E * q = 12 * 0.5 = 6 N.
Answer: A force equal to 6 N. acts on the charge.
